I mailed books at media mail rate for the first time today (have just been doing 1st class or parcel post) and I hope I did it right.  I don't use the PBS wrapping as I don't have a printer at home, so I hand addressed them, weighed them on the scale (13.2 oz, darn it) and bought 2.47 stamp for that one and 2.81 for the hardback in a box (2 lbs and some oz).  I marked both of them with a black sharpie "media mail".  The hardback was in a cardboard box wrapped in a plastic bag.  Will I get in trouble because of the plastic bag?  Seems like they are really picky about those kinds of things.  Thanks for any advice!

Rachel, under 16 ounces is $2.13 to mail media rate.  The 13 ounce mark is when you have to start using trackable postage, or if using stamps, hand the package in at the post office.
